it's Alice's 27th Birthday today, but she is in no mood to celebrate. All she is feeling is emptiness inside her. She wanted to be anywhere but here. While staring at the blank wall all she can think is that she is good for nothing, a loser, demotivated person. Her thoughts were interrupted when her Dad came with a box in his hand. He gave it to her and she realizes that this gift is from her Mom, who died due to cancer. Along with the gift she notices a letter which was written by her Mom during her last days. She wanted her daughter to read this letter on her 27th Birthday as she wanted to give her daughter a final message. _________________________________________ ''.....Unless you won't embrace yourself completely, you cannot expect anyone to accept you'. Those words changed something in me and I started viewing myself in a different view. I can see in the mirror that the girl had a smile on her face, her eyes were shining. On that day I fell in love with....'Myself'...."
